You can call your local hospital or health network and ask them about any programs they have for shadowing doctors. I did a program one summer at a hospital in my area where I shadowed a doc. I shadowed a doctor where I go to school as well, and a completely different hospital allowed me to do pretty much the same thing. I would contact local hospitals in your area and ask them what sorts of options they have for students to shadow doctors, and specifically ask for a DO. The only reason I got to shadow a DO at his office was because it was through a mutual acquaintance, otherwise I found no luck contacting them personally. Good luck!

if you have the numbers for those local DOs, then you probably have their addresses (office, not home!). Go there in person and ask the receptionist if you can talk to the doc about coming and observing/shadowing. Say that your applying etc. This worked just fine for me. Luck!
